For this recipe, you need shredded chicken breasts. I grilled my own chicken breasts and then used my stand mixer to shred them. In case you didn't know, this is an amazing hack! It's super tedious to shred chicken using forks. You can just put chicken in a stand mixer and mix it with the paddle attachment.
Key Ingredients

Chicken breasts: As I said earlier, I grilled my own chicken breasts and then shredded them using my stand mixer with the paddle attachment. You can also use a rotisserie chicken if you have that.
Cream cheese: You'll need one 8-ounce package of cream cheese.
Ranch dressing: I highly recommend using the refrigerated kind or making it yourself. The shelf-stable is not nearly as good.
Buffalo Sauce: I used Frank's Red Hot Buffalo Sauce for wings.
Cheddar cheese: Of course, this would not be complete without a generous helping of cheddar cheese. You can also use mozzarella if you like.
Instructions

STEP 1: In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, cream cheese, ranch dressing, buffalo sauce, and 1 cup of cheddar cheese.

STEP 2: Pour the mixture into a 1.5-quart baking dish.

STEP 3: Top with the remaining cheddar cheese.

STEP 4: Bake at 350°F for 20-25 minutes until the cheese is melted and the sides are bubbling up. Enjoy! I served this with tortilla chips, carrots, and celery sticks. Also scattering some chopped parsley on top will make it look much better.

Buffalo Chicken Dip
Ingredients
- 1 ½ pounds cooked chicken breasts (shredded; about 3 large breasts)
- 1 (8-ounce) package cream cheese (softened)
- ⅔ cup ranch dressing
- ⅔ cup Frank's RedHot Buffalo Sauce
- 1 ½ cups shredded cheddar cheese (or mozzarella)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F.
- In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, cream cheese, ranch dressing, buffalo sauce, and 1 cup of cheddar cheese. Mix until well combined
- Spread into a 1.5qt baking dish and sprinkle the remaining ½ cup of cheese on top.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es until the cheese is lightly browned and the sides are bubbling up.
- Serve immediately with chips and/or carrots and celery. Enjoy!
